Destiny

When two world collides,the old and the new one can only reflect. It is the mixture and unison of two cultures and one spirit.when the African came to Haiti they learn to embrace the Taino cultures and carry on a tradition. Haiti is a little island that is seperated from mother Africa. It embraces with the Tainos to create Ayiti Kisleya Boyo (High mountains). As the Tainos dissipated , it is the Black Africans that remain to cultivate and embrace this soil and find its cultural heritage. I cannot forget my past and forget history. it si what we are today a mosaic of the races. But it is the unions of those people that make us who we are today. It is through our cultural and ancestral heritage that we reamin connected to our mother land. We must love our world to understand its meaning. The sea brings our world together as one.
